Two-Factor Authentication
Two-factor authentication (2FA) is one of the most important security measures that you can take to protect your Kraken Pro trading account and funds. This is a process whereby a user is required to provide two pieces of information in order to gain access to their account. This could be something like a password and a code sent to their mobile phone or an authentication app such as Google Authenticator. This means that even if someone were to gain access to your password, they would still need the second factor in order to gain access to your account.
Strong Passwords
Another important best practice for securing your Kraken Pro trading account and funds is to use strong passwords. This means that your passwords should be long (at least 8 characters) and contain a mix of upper and lower case letters, numbers, and special characters. It is also important to use a different password for each account, and to avoid using the same password for multiple accounts.

Regular Security Checks
Finally, it is important to regularly check the security of your Kraken Pro trading account and funds. This means checking for any suspicious activity, such as unauthorised logins or withdrawals, as well as ensuring that your password and other security measures are up to date. It is also important to keep your operating system and web browser up to date, as this can help to protect against security vulnerabilities.
